Executive Summary
509 Madrid Rd in Odessa, Texas offers a well-equipped industrial facility totaling approximately ±12,900 SF of improvements on ±4 acres in the heart of the Permian Basin. The property is ideally suited for oilfield service, fabrication, equipment maintenance, or industrial support operations, with a layout designed to accommodate heavy equipment and commercial vehicle activity.
The improvements include a primary ±4,500 SF crane-served shop equipped with a 10-Ton overhead bridge crane and 3-phase power, providing a functional environment for heavy-duty industrial work. Two additional ±2,400 SF shops provide supplemental workspace and are crane-ready with single-phase power, offering flexibility for a variety of industrial users.
The property features four drive-through bays with a combination of four 18' overhead doors and two 16' overhead doors, allowing efficient access for large trucks, trailers, and equipment. The office component totals approximately ±3,600 SF and includes seven private offices, reception area, and conference room, providing a practical administrative layout for management and operations.
The ±4-acre stabilized yard provides ample space for equipment storage, staging, and truck circulation. The site is fully fenced and gated, offering controlled access and security. Utilities include septic service, and the property is located within county jurisdiction with no known zoning restrictions, allowing flexibility for a wide range of industrial and oilfield-related uses.
Conveniently located in the Permian Basin industrial corridor, the property offers quick access to major regional routes including Interstate 20, Highway 385, and Loop 338, providing strong connectivity to both Midland and Odessa and the surrounding oilfield service areas.
